The Paths We've Blazed

The APA Heritage Foundation and APICC invite you to “The Paths We’ve Blazed - How the I-Hotel Ignited the APA Arts Scene."

The Ethnic Studies Movement and the eviction of seniors from the I-Hotel gave rise to a generation of Asian American artists who responded to the challenges of protecting their community, and in doing so birthed Asian American arts in the Bay Area and beyond. This exhibit will be looking back at the story of the I-Hotel and three critical organizations that are celebrating milestone anniversaries in 2022: Kearny Street Workshop (50), Asian Improv aRts (35) and API Cultural Center (25) who were propelled and shaped by these historic events. We will be premiering a new video featuring Nancy Hom, Francis Wong and Pamela Wu-Kochiyama, telling their stories of how the I-Hotel shaped their leadership, artistry, and activism.
